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: executer un exe (source C++) avec du java [ Archives / API ] (zebulaon)

vendredi 17 janvier 2003 à 14:41:36 | executer un exe (source C++) avec du java

zebulaon

Bonjour,
Je voudrais savoir comment on peut interfacer un programme C++ avec du java.
Je dispose des sources d'un prog ecrit en C++ et j'aurai besoin de recuperer des elements de ce programme ds un autre programme en java.
L'ideal serait de pouvoir rassembler les 2 types de sources ds un meme prog ecrit en java...
Si qqn pourrait me mettre sur une piste...
Merci

vendredi 17 janvier 2003 à 15:58:44 | Re : executer un exe (source C++) avec du java

JHelp

Tu peux éxécuter une ligne de commande en Java et donc demander le lancement d'un autre programme. Tu peux ensuite récupéré sa sortie standard et envoyer des infos sur cette même sortie.
Par exemple :

try
{
Process process=Runtime.getRunTime().exec(comande);
InputStream lire=process.getInputStream();
OutputStream ecrire=process.getOutputStream();
InputStream erreur=process.getErrorStream();
}
catch(Exception e)
{
e.printStackTrace();
}


JHelp

lundi 20 janvier 2003 à 18:45:13 | Re : executer un exe (source C++) avec du java

zebulaon

Réponse acceptée !
Pour ceux que ça interesse, pour interfacer du java et du C++, il existe le JNI: Java Native Interface. Toutes les info(s) sont sur le site de sun



Cette discussion est classé dans : exe, java, programme, source, executer


Répondre à ce message

Sujets en rapport avec ce message

exe java [ par CHKDSK2K ] Bonjour, Je vooudrais creer un programme exe appartir du fichier .class ou .java comment faire car j'ai essaye plusieur programme mais j'y suis jms ar Compiler et executer un programme à l'interieur d'un programme java [ par auvrayju ] Bonjour,Je travaille actuellement sur un projet. Dans celui ci je modifie et crée des fichier . java (Filewriter). J'aurais besoin de compiler et d'ex appeler un programme java depuis un autre fichier java [ par gefrey54 ] salutJe cherche a executer un programme depuis un fichier java qui se situe dans un autre fichier java. dois-je utiliser la methode init()?En faite le exécution d'une application à partir d'un programme java [ par didiss1 ] Bonjour;De retour mais cette fois je cherche quelques détails!!Je suis arrivé à exécuter une application depuis java mais pas l'application que je vou Problème applet affichage d'un exe [ par buddy6 ] Bonjour ! Voila j’ai une applet java qui normalement ouvre un programme .exe. Quand je la lance depuis ma page web, mon exécutable se met bien en rou executer un programme java avec ms-dos [ par sniperiza ] bonsoir a tous, j'ai un problème quand je veux compiler un programme java sous ms-dos , la commande javac n'est pas reconnu en tant que commande inter problème de programmation en java [ par beberto56 ] Bonjour tous le monde,je vous expose mon problème, je suis débutant en java et voila ce que j'ai:j'ai deux répertoire sur mon c:/users/jbernard qui so [a supprimer] besoin d'un code source java pour ecrire un logiciel [ par louk73 ] Mon sujet est le suivant.Mise en place d'un logiciel de gestion des départements (au moins 3) d'un établissement universitaire en mode client serveur: exécuter une commande non java avant l'exécution de mon programme java [ par 1985_bisengar ] Bonjour, j'ai besoin de rendre mes .class persistants , et cela en utilisant une commande Osjcfp (je travaille avec object store) j'aimerais savoir es Probleme sur le click d'un bouton [ par kam81 ] Bonjour,Je travaille avec netbeans 5.5, j'ai créé une applet qui se connecte à un serveur ftp, et puis je l'ai deployée dans une application web et ça


Nos sponsors

Sondage...

CalendriCode

Décembre 2008
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
293031    

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,234 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.